Comparing Kingdom Hearts To JRPG

The debate about whether or not Kingdom Hearts is a JRPG has been ongoing for years. It’s easy to see why so many people are curious about this game. After all, it has many of the same characteristics of a JRPG, but it also has some unique features that set it apart from other games in the genre.

To help answer this question, let’s take a look at how Kingdom Hearts compares to traditional JRPGs. First, Kingdom Hearts has a real-time battle system rather than the turn-based system that is used in most JRPGs. This makes the game more action-oriented and fast-paced, which gives it a bit of a different feel than other JRPGs.

Another thing that sets Kingdom Hearts apart is the use of Disney characters and worlds. This is something that you don’t find in many other JRPGs, and it helps to give the game a unique flavor. Here are just a few of the Kingdom Hearts spin-off titles that fans can explore:

Kingdom Hearts: Chain of Memories – This is a card-based RPG for the Game Boy Advance.

Kingdom Hearts: 358/2 Days – This is an action RPG for the Nintendo DS.

Kingdom Hearts: Birth by Sleep – This is an action RPG for the PSP.

Kingdom Hearts coded – This is a puzzle-based RPG for the Nintendo DS.

Kingdom Hearts 3D: Dream Drop Distance – This is an action RPG for the Nintendo 3DS.
